Output e5c5c03f6cd24ec2a58e9f56750db51af3c29e29d7eb5e660cad414594d64140:5

value
4600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890409770893d876c5b933a9e8e0028123818dca OP_EQUAL
address
3EBVLKQzEkZcQcm5kvPPAGY44oMHNzkwkX
transaction
e5c5c03f6cd24ec2a58e9f56750db51af3c29e29d7eb5e660cad414594d64140
spent
true